Company and Role Overview

Ganotec is a comprehensive heavy industrial contractor serving Canada's industrial sector with self-performed disciplines such as civil, structural steel erection, heavy mechanical equipment installation, process piping, electrical/instrumentation, and controls. They operate under various commercial contract styles including full turnkey, EPC, design build, T&M, and discipline-specific packages. The company emphasizes early collaboration among owners, equipment suppliers, and engineers to craft cost-effective project execution strategies.

This Mechanical Estimator position, based in Oakville, Ontario, involves preparing, reviewing, and presenting detailed discipline estimates for project proposals. The role supports project teams by developing conceptual estimates, performing cost analyses, and maintaining historical cost databases. The incumbent will assist in establishing department procedures and guide others in estimating specific tasks.

Responsibilities

  • Calculate installation quantities using drawings and specifications
  • Generate detailed cost estimates for significant projects locally and across Canada
  • Deliver comprehensive estimates for large and complex scope work
  • Analyze owner plans and specifications to deeply understand project requirements and devise construction plans as a foundation for estimates
  • Examine tender and contract documents, incorporating input from the legal department
  • Coordinate with planning, scheduling, procurement, and proposal teams
  • Communicate estimates effectively to management and external clients
  • Maintain professional, trustworthy relationships with clients, subcontractors, and suppliers
  • Collaborate with the estimating team to foster continuous improvements

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ree or Technical Diploma in Mechanical Engineering or equivalent mechanical estimating experience
  • More than 5 years of mechanical estimating experience on major projects
  • Strong knowledge of the Canadian construction market
  • Proficient English communication skills; French language skills are preferred
  • Skilled in presentations and negotiations
  • Advanced proficiency with MS Office; familiarity with Bluebeam software advantageous
  • Experience in industrial, hydro, oil and gas, and mining sectors is desirable
  • Willingness to travel for site visits or client meetings related to estimates
  • Highly organized, adaptable, detail-focused, collaborative, and capable of managing multiple tasks
  • Ability to prioritize assignments and meet deadlines amidst shifting demands

Compensation and Benefits

The base salary range is $90,000 to $140,000 annually, with variation based on education, experience, skills, and location. Full-time employees receive a comprehensive benefits package including superior medical, dental, and vision coverage for employees and dependents, voluntary wellness and employee assistance programs, life and disability insurance, retirement plans with matching contributions, and generous paid time off.
